Output e21a59a40ff1b1a4d1bef020142ee8ac788c1860fef5b8da6432d55cab995aa7: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c26aa2312a5cc037ca365ad815ba5adc49b90de OP_EQUAL
address
35iTySv6ev8HUx5DKHVdubogNXKAne3w9S
transaction
e21a59a40ff1b1a4d1bef020142ee8ac788c1860fef5b8da6432d55cab995aa7
spent
true